HUAWEI-RPR-MIB
The HUAWEI-RPR-TRAP-MIB contains objects to
Monitor the RPR TRAPs.
*********************************
RPR TRAP
**********************************
This RPR TRAP consists of the following TRAPs:
1 : hwRPRexcessReservedRateDefect
2 : hwRPRprotMisconfigDefect
3 : hwRPRtopoChange
4 : hwRPRtopoInvalidDefect
5 : hwRPRduplicateMacAddressDefect
6 : hwRPRtopoInstabilityDefect
7 : hwRPRtopoStabilityRestore
8 : hwRPRPhyIfEventTrap
9 : hwRPRLogicIfEventTrap

This defect indicates that the amount of reserved bandwidth on a ringlet exceeds the available LINK_RATE. When an excess reserved rate defect is present, a notification may be generated. |

On RPR ring, to detect the connection, a kind of packet is send between neighbor RPR nodes, This kind of packet is SC(Single-Choke) packet, If a node cannot receive SC packet from neighbor node in KEEPALIVE time, then there is failure between the two nodes. When happened, auto protection is executed by software.! |

Optical fiber is connected in error. i.e the east direction of one node is connected with east direction of another node, or the west direction of one node is connected with west direction of another node! |

In double RPR operating mode, east and west directions of one rpr node lay on two RPR cards, These two cards are internally conntected by Gigaibit-ethernet, which is called MATE interface. The RPR nodes cannot work normaly under condition of MATE error.! |

On RPR physical layer, link connection is detected through physical singal. When can't receive physical singal, then local node from neighbor node, LOS(lost of signal) alarm is report, auto protection is executed by software.! |

A critical severity defect that indicates the presence of mismatched-protection-configuration stations, based on the value returned by MismatchedProtection(). When a protection configuration defect is present on the station, a notification may be generated. |

A critical severity defect indicating that an invalid entry has been found within the scope of the topology,the stations on the ring excess the MAX_STATIONS or the local station has one or more duplicate secondary MAC addresses. When a topology entry invalid defect ,exceeing MaxStations or duplicate secondary MAC addresses is present, a notification may be generated. |
